18
RightScale-Zend Joint Customer Case Study: Mediaspike March 7, 2012 Watch the video of this webinar

RightScale Webinar: RightScale Zend Joint Customer Case Study - Mediaspike

Embed Size (px)

Citation preview

RightScale-Zend Joint Customer Case Study: Mediaspike

March 7, 2012

Watch the video of this webinar

# 2

Your Panel TodayPresenting• Uri Budnik, Director, ISV Partner Program, RightScale

@uribudnik• Kent Mitchell, Sr. Director, Product Management, Zend

@zend• Mark Moline, Technical Director, Mediaspike

@polloboy

Q&A • Andrew DeMille, Account Manager, RightScale

Please use the “Questions” window to ask questions any time!

# 3

Agenda

• Introductions• Brief Review of RightScale-Zend Partnership• Mediaspike’s Deployment of the RightScale

Zend Solution Pack • Open Forum / Q&A

Please use the “Questions” window to ask questions any time!

# 4

RightScale Real Customers, Real Deployments, Real Benefits

• Managed Cloud Deployments for 4 Years• More than 45,000 users; launched over 3.7MM servers• Powering the largest production deployments on the cloud

# 5

Why Cloud Management? Automation - Choice - Control

# 7

Fully Integrated IDE

Self-serve setup

Team Support

Application Fabric

Cloud Development PlatformComplete PHP App Server

Transparent Scaling

Application Provisioning

App Performance Management

Caching Job Queuing

Diagnostics / Root cause analysis

Support

High Availability

Security Hot fixes

Centralized Configuration

Auto scalingCloud Infrastructure

Templates & Configuration

Design and Develop

Runtime Platform Manage

Eclipse IDE

PHP Tooling

PRODUCTION ECOSYSTEM

Why Zend PHP vs Open Source

# 8

Flexible and Configurable PaaS• Pre-configured Zend PHP

architecture to speed time to market

• Based on Zend and RightScale’s best practices

• Auto-scaling based on system and application load metrics, supported by load balancing

• PHP session clustering for high availability

• Redundant database with failover and recovery

# 10

Who is Mediaspike?

• 10 years old

• Boston, MA

• 7 full time employees

• 2 dogs: Chester & Mason

# 11

What do we do?

• Mediaspike generates leads for online and traditional colleges and universities

• Two primary sites: AchieveYourCareer.com

FindYourDegree.com

• Custom Matching Algorithms to find best fit for students

• Targeted high-volume campaigns

# 12

Process

• Leads flow in through web sites• Processed and validated in Central Processing• Sent to client systems in real time

# 13

The Old Way

• One giant server being fed from our subversion repository and backing up data to S3.

# 14

Problems

• No room for traffic bursts• FRAGILE - Don't want to upgrade X because it may

break Y.• Single point of failure - could shut down our

business for hours to days. • Encouraged manual "hacking". Rather than run the

proper build script, I'll just tweak this file on the live site. It's OK...

# 15

With RightScale and Zend

# 16

Development Environment

• All devs use Zend Studio• Push code to in-house Zend Server or to VM instance on

laptops for dev cycles• Commit to SVN, push to Testing server at AWS• Test, push to Production Array with RightScale scripts

# 17

Benefits

• No more single point of (disastrous) failure• MySQL master/slave replication and EBS Snapshot

backups "just work"• Better reliability because everything is scripted.

No more manual build processes• Flexibility to change architecture as needed• Increased capacity, of course

# 18

Getting Started and Q&A• Sign up for the RightScale Free Edition:

RightScale.com/free• Contact RightScale

(866) 720-0208

[email protected] • Contact Zend

[email protected]• Contact Mediaspike

[email protected]

More InfoRead the Whitepaper

RightScale.com/whitepapersWebinar archives:

RightScale.com/webinarsZend.com/webinars